Abruzzo Day 3. 18th April.
It was almost completely dark by the time the procession had passed by the place where we were positioned. On our way to catch the coach I saw this lovely night view which I wanted to capture. I do not carry a tripod with me and all my shots are with the camera hand held. This is one of the shots I took before we caught the escalator to where the coach was parked.
Chieti is a medieval city and built on high ground to better protect itself from attacks. To save visitors time and fatigue this very long escalator – shown in the well-lit tube – was built to take up people from the parking area straight to the city centre.
